Breaking News-RTRS-UPDATE 2-Malaysia struggling to sell palm oil on recession

KUALA LUMPUR, Nov 7 (Reuters) - Malaysia faces an uphill task in exporting its surplus palm oil thanks to a deepening global recession and environmentalist pressure over biofuels, a minister said on Friday.
Commodities Minister Peter Chin said with palm oil output expected to top 18 million tonnes in 2009, the government will work with largest producer Indonesia to cut supplies through replanting schemes and aim to revive domestic demand through biodiesel mandates.
Both Southeast Asian nations will also embark on a campaign against European Union's proposal for tough eco-standards for biofuels, which also include Germany's proposal for the exclusion of palm oil for biodiesel use.
